Loan Assessor

2 weeks ago


Hobart, Australia MyState Limited Full time

You’ll be joining our talented Loan Assessment team working closely with our amazing broker network.

On the job training will be provided, but what we’re really looking for is the right mix of speed, accuracy and an all round keen-to-get-things-done attitude.

We’re quickly earning a reputation as one of Australia’s fastest growing home lenders, and we’re really excited to keep growing our team.

**Here’s what you’ll be doing**:

- Building relationships with stakeholders inside and outside the business
- Delivering outstanding service to internal and external customers with a high level of accuracy and efficiency
- Meeting (and exceeding) service level agreements
- All while complying with all legislative requirements including, NCCP, Privacy Act and AML/CTF

**Here are the key skills and strengths we’re looking for**:

- A solid understanding of industry codes and practices (or, if you don’t know these codes and practices yet, a commitment to learning them)
- Self motivation and initiative. We’re looking for someone who doesn’t wait to be told what to do, and strives for the best outcomes every time
- The ability to hold and maintain a Delegated Lending Authority (DLA)
- A great communication style. You’ll be chatting to lots of different people, from customers, to brokers, to colleagues in many different business areas, so a warm and professional manner is important
- Excellent organisational skills, including being able to prioritise tasks and meet expected timeframes
- You’ll be working independently with mínimal supervision, but you’ll still need to contribute to a positive and professional team environment
- Bonus skill: if you can interpret financial statements that’s a huge plus
